Maintain Your Brain (MYB)i is a randomised controlled trial (RCT) of multiple online interventions designed to target modifiable risk factors for Alzheimer's disease and dementia. Traditional clinical trial management systems (CTMS) requirements consist of features such as management of the study, site, subject (participant), clinical outcomes, external and internal requests, education, data extraction and reporting, security, and privacy. In addition to fulfilling these traditional requirements, MYB has a specific set of features that needs to be fulfilled. These specific requirements include: (i) support for multiple interventions within a study, (ii) flexible interoperability options with third-party software providers, (iii) study participants being able to engage in online activities via web-based interfaces throughout the trial (from screening to follow-up), (iv) ability to algorithmically personalize trial activities based on the needs of the participant, and (v) the ability to handle large volumes of data over a long period. This paper outlines how the existing CTMSs fall short in meeting these specific requirements. The presented system architecture, development approach and lessons learned in the implementation of the MYB digital platform will inform researchers attempting to implement CTMSs for trials comparable to MYB in the future.
